27 Holly Hap Christmas Dance was held this evening and a large crowd attended and everyone had an enjoyable time. lb hopetl -JANUARY- 1 Happy New Year Everybodyll 6 And back to school again. My how good it feels to be back ------ Oh yea :11! 7 Why so many scared looks on the faces of Thes- pians? Reason? Declamatory tryouts. Results were: Oratorical-Robert PinkowskigBenedict Pag- ao; Joe Tarasewicz. Dramatic-Ardythe Mueller; Patricia Carlin; Dorothy Schreiner. Humorous- Dorothy Selner; Betty Peterson; Jeanne Wadak. 10 De Padua plays Park Falls and beats them 22-30. Come on boys, we're all for you. 15 What: Another victory! Yep, over our old ri- vals Ashland High with a score of 32--36. Our boys certainly showed extraordinary fighting spirit. 17 Whoopee! Are we going to town. De Padua beats Bessemer 31-29. Keep it up--we want more. 21 St. Agnes Day--no school. Dear me: This con- stant winning gets to be a bore, but hold your hats 'cause the headlines says, De Padua Tops Whahburn High 27-11 . Good old Innes sure can plunk 'em in. . 22-23 . Many brows are unnaturally furrowedt Reason??? That same regular gruesome task-semester exams. 24 Ah: Now I can relax. Tests are over. 0h death where is thy sting? Yea, kiddies, we got beat by St. Ambrose 26-13 but our boys played a very good game and we're on to more victories: 27 New semester begins. Father Jahn addressed the student body. Gee, I sure am glad I don't live in China. lhyl? Say, didn't you hear Father Norbert. He gave a very interesting talk on his missionary work in China. 28 We watched the DPH-Superior Cathedral game to a thrilling finish when our quintet lost during the closing minutes of play by only 2 small points. The final score being 27-29.

-DECEMBER- 5 Thespians present an Amateur Hour this morn- ing for the High Sch001 and this afternoon for the grades. It consisted of 5 one-act p1ays-- School of Rhythm , Gorilla , Who Gets The Car Tonite, Whether or Not , Slightly Exag- gerated. First home basketball game--Mellen-- boy did we give them a trimminglt 4 Retreat begins. Father Norbert, retreat mas- ter. 5 Mmm, mmmmmmm, mm tean't talk, retreatt Mmmmmmm. 6 Mm mmmm mm--High Mass at St. Agnes Church. 7 Freshmen elect officers. 8 Reception of 96 new members in the Sodality of Our Lady. The Reception Breakfast was arranged by the Social Life Committee for all the Sodal- ists. Thanks to the Senior Mothers in appreci- ation for the wonderful breakfast. 10 Everyone was present at the to 3:30. '0' 0 y 13 Another big game. We topped Hayward 28-15.---I told you! we certainly are warming up. 16 Big snow storm and no school. Boy, what luck. 17 Thespians Christmas Party came off this even- ing. A11 present had an enjoyable evening. 18 A P.T.A. Christmas Program was held this even- ing at the social hall. Thespians presented a contribution of three one-act plays. About 550 people were present. 20 Christmas parties were held in evary room this afternoon. Christmas vacation began at 3:30 on the dot. Thespians cheered up the patients in the Pure Air Sanitorium in Bayfield by giving 3 plays for them. 22 Another exciting basketball game--but we didn't win. Courage kiddies, this is just the beginn- ing. Just the beginning. 25 Merry Christmas.
